How many Technical Authors are in the UK? Here’s the answer

It’s quite difficult to know how many Technical Authors there are in the United Kingdom. The profession doesn’t have its own Standard Occupational Classification code, so there are no official statistics. We can estimate the number of Technical Authors in the IT sector.
